The E68891-015 - NetApp 4 x Ports 1Gb/s Ethernet PCI-e Adapter provides multiple Ethernet connections through a single PCI Express interface, fitting into environments that require dependable, high-speed network links. It balances throughput and stability, making it suitable for networked storage systems and server setups where consistent data exchange is necessary. |

| Brand | NetApp |
| Technical Information | |
|---|---|
| Product Type | Network Interface Card |
| Data Rate (Speed) | 1GbE |
| Number of Ports | 4-Port (Quad) |
| Connectivity & Physical | |
|---|---|
| Form Factor | Standard PCIe Card |
| Port Type | RJ-45 (Copper) |
| Weight | 3.00 |
| Condition | Refurbished |
